Brian Houston
“Sometimes I think we spend a lot of time fleeing from the devil, when we really need to stand our ground. The Bible doesn't teach us to flee from the devil; it teaches us to draw near to God, to resist the devil, so he will flee from you. We don't need to worry about running away from the devil and trying to hide from him. We simply need to focus on drawing near to God and his purpose for our lives. This is how we can best resist the devil. When he sees us drawing closer and closer to God, when he watches as our faith muscles grow bigger and stronger, he's forced to accept defeat.”
Brian Houston, Live Love Lead: Your Best Is Yet to Come!

Abraham   Verghese
“All sons should write down every word of what their fathers have to say to them. I tried. Why did it take an illness for me to recognize the value of time with him? It seems we humans never learn. And so we relearn the lesson every generation and then want to write epistles. We proselytize to our friends and shake them by the shoulders and tell them, “Seize the day! What matters is this moment!”
Abraham Verghese, Cutting for Stone

John Eldredge
“Faith is something that looks backward - we remember the ways God has come through for his people, and for us, and our belief is strengthened that he will come through again. Love is exercised in the present moment; we love in the "now." Hope reaches into the future to take hold of something we do not yet have, may not even see.”
John Eldredge, All Things New: Heaven, Earth, and the Restoration of Everything You Love

Frank M. Snowden III
“Public health policy needs to be informed by history. A policy that either ignores the past or draws misguided lessons from it can all too easily result in serious mistakes and a colossal waste of resources.”
Frank M. Snowden III, Epidemics and Society: From the Black Death to the Present
